Nestled in Old town Batroun, Mariolino is a authentic place for italian cuisine such as pizza, pasta, antipasti and salads. 🍕
You can choose from a wide range of italian specialities served with fresh ingredients and getting the feeling of little Italy while sitting in the Batroun town. Pizza Bresaola, Pizza Bufala or a trio of italian dips. The place offers also a lot of drinks like several sorts of wine, aperitivos and more alcoholic and non-alcoholic choices. 🍷
This place is perfect to have a nice lunch, a romantic dinner or some good italian food with a group of friends while enjoying the time.
Mariolino is located in Batroun and a second branch in Bakish.
